Flashcarts that work on DSi will work with Luma's patches. my AceKard 2i and my Gateway Blue card both boot fine. older DS flashcarts that need a patched TWLFirm will not work. My AceKard 2i does not require Stage2 launcher or anything and boots from the home screen just fine.
